Nutritional Benefits of Cucurbita Maxima Seeds
Cucurbita Maxima seeds stand out due to their rich nutritional profile. They are an excellent source of essential fatty acids, protein, and dietary fiber. According to the USDA FoodData Central database, a 1-ounce (28-gram) serving of pumpkin seeds contains:
- Protein: 7 grams
- Fat: 13 grams
- Carbohydrates: 5 grams
- Fiber: 1.1 grams
- Iron: 25% of the Daily Value (DV)
- Magnesium: 37% of the DV
These seeds are also rich in antioxidants, particularly vitamin E and carotenoids, which promote overall health and may reduce the risk of chronic diseases.
Culinary Uses of Cucurbita Maxima Seeds
Cucurbita Maxima seeds can be enjoyed in various ways:
1. Roasted Snacks
One of the most popular ways to enjoy these seeds is by roasting them. Roasting enhances their flavor and creates a crunchy snack that can be seasoned with salt, spices, or even sweet coatings. A study published in the Journal of Food Science notes that roasting can also improve the bioavailability of certain nutrients.
2. Salads and Toppings
Cucurbita Maxima seeds can be sprinkled on salads or used as a topping for soups and roasted vegetables. They add a delightful crunch and an extra boost of nutrition to any dish. Their nutty flavor complements various ingredients, making them a versatile addition to many meals.
3. Baking Ingredient
These seeds can also be incorporated into baked goods like bread, muffins, and granola. A study in the Journal of Agricultural and Food Chemistry indicates that pumpkin seeds can enhance the textural qualities of baked products while increasing their nutritional content.
Health Benefits of Cucurbita Maxima Seeds
Incorporating Cucurbita Maxima seeds into your diet can yield several health benefits. Research has shown that these seeds can support heart health due to their high magnesium content, which helps regulate blood pressure and prevent cardiovascular diseases. Furthermore, they may assist in maintaining prostate health and have been linked to reduced symptoms of benign prostatic hyperplasia (BPH) in men, according to a study in the journal *Nutrition Research*.
Non-Culinary Uses of Cucurbita Maxima Seeds
Beyond their culinary applications, Cucurbita Maxima seeds offer several other uses:
1. Natural Pesticide
Cucurbita Maxima seeds can act as a natural pesticide due to their chemical composition. The compounds found in these seeds can deter certain insects, making them beneficial for organic gardening practices.
2. Skin Care
Oil extracted from Cucurbita Maxima seeds is often used in skin care products due to its moisturizing properties. Rich in fatty acids and antioxidants, this oil can help nourish and protect the skin, making it ideal for dry skin treatments.
3. Fertilizer
Cucurbita Maxima seeds can also be composted to create organic fertilizer. This process helps enrich the soil with nutrients, promoting healthy plant growth. The sustainability aspect of using pumpkin seeds for gardening encourages eco-friendly practices.
